Trifle's Story
Male, domestic short hair, brown tabby<br/><br/>Trifles name should really be Trifle the Bold!, underlined, exclamation mark. Trifle is big personality in a small package, with intense expressive eyes that exude intelligence. Trifle is marked like a Bengal cat and has a long lean athletic body. He is a cat you notice!<br/><br/>Trifle LOVES people. He craves contact and cuddles. Purrs instantly when he sees you and will shove his face in your hand before you can even attempt to pet him.<br/><br/>Trifle is enthusiastic and passionate about everything in his life. Treats best thing ever. Pats best thing ever. Toys best thing ever. <br/><br/>Trifle can become over stimulated and a bit mouthy when being petted, but only because he LOVES the contact so intensely that he gets overwhelmed by his feelings. He would need a cat savvy home with no small children so he can continue to receive guidance and learn appropriate ways to express his affection. <br/> <br/>Trifle was born outside and did not have human contact early in life so is still learning about humans and life indoors. He may be startled and hide when encountering new people or situation, but with physical reassurance from pats and cuddles he quickly gains confidence. Trifle foster mom is teaching him that being picked up is not scary and every day he gets braver and braver. His foster mom can easily pick him up and hold him for cuddles. Strangers still need to earn his trust. <br/><br/>Trifle is quiet and tidy. He has no issues finding the litterbox and rarely meows (but purrs constantly!)<br/><br/>Trifle is indifferent toward other cats and dogs. He mostly ignores them, preferring human contact over another animals. He would be fine with other animals in the house, but would likely not be best friends with them<br/><br/>Compatibility<br/>Cats and Dogs: Yes, Trifle is indifferent toward other cats and dogs. He mostly ignores them, preferring human contact over another animals. He would be fine with other animals in the house, but would likely not be best friends with them<br/>Kids: No small children, older tweens and up who are cat savvy can be considered who will take the time to help him gain confidence<br/><br/>Age<br/>Estimated age: 9 months<br/><br/>Veterinary Information<br/> Trifle has been neutered<br/> Vaccinated for FVRCP and Feline Leukemia<br/> Microchipped<br/> Deflead and dewormed<br/> Six weeks of pet insurance<br/> Health record card<br/> Specific diagnostic testing may also have been done as each cat's health may warrant while in CatNap's care.
